Hi all,
I have been driving my 04 TL for about seven years but now that I have moved away from home I'm trying to manage the maintenance on my own. An issue that I've been dealing with for the last year is that the electronics have been acting strange. Things like the speakers being really quiet, the headlights being dim (I've changed the bulbs and balast), and the latest thing is the cars battery dies if I leave it sitting a few days (battery and alternator test good per a local automation store). I've been trying to think it through and I was thinking maybe it's something like the serpentine belt or tensioner but before I attempt to replace it I wanted to see if anyone here had any advice for a novice car guy. Thanks in advance.

Unplug the hands free link module and do a "parasitic" drain test. Youtube will help with both!

I pulled the hands free link a few years ago after it started draining the battery so that isn't the issue. I'll look up the parasitic load test you mentioned and see how that goes.
#4
Drifting
Speakers being quiet
- Amp is failing and most likely needs to be rebuilt or replaced
- Most common issue are failing capacitors in the amp
- I have rebuilt three of them, takes about an hour of work assuming you know how to desolder/solder
Headlights being dim
- how dim? what are you comparing to?
- lenses cloudy?
- how old are the bulbs?
- if you connect a charger, does it get brighter?
- does the brightness change with the engine off or on?
- have you measured voltage at the battery or fuse block with the engine off and on?
Dead battery
- usually HFL...but you said already disconnected
- other common culprit is the A/C clutch relay sticking
- do the parasitic draw tests and you can at least figure out which circuit is pulling current and go from there
